Let me start with a baby say from 9 months to 1-yr old one:
-Fill one small leak proof plastic can half with water.Another one with some cheerios and the other one with a pencap. Give the three cans to him and see him shake them and he'll tell you which kind of sound he prefers.
-Fill a ziplc partially with water and another one with rice, seal and give it to the baby and he'll tel you which feels better.
-Lets talk about rhythm...it is very easy to make bablies respond to rhythms and develop their grey matters in their brains. Walk with the baby in your hand everyday for atleast 15 minutes in a pattern or rhythm...Say out the pattern loud..like 1,2,1,2 or 12,123,12,123,12,123
(while you say 12 keep a step and while you say 123 keep another step..so both legs are still for different lengths of time but the pattern is repeated)..or 1234,1,1234,1....etc...Watch your child listen to it keenly and with lot of thrill.Do these activities when the baby in a perfect mood...after a nap , food or anytime hes happy..
This exercise will develop a sense of involvement and will also increase concentration in babies.
